site stats

Graphic culling

WebDec 8, 2024 · For cluster culling, you may want to compute additional data in separate buffers for cache efficiency, such as bounding boxes, bounding spheres, and normal cones. In the following examples, I used a 128-bit … WebUniversity of California, San Diego

Back-face culling - Wikipedia

WebDec 10, 2024 · hausmaus. Use this function in situations where you want to draw the same mesh for a particular amount of times using an instanced shader. Meshes are not further … Web1.Culling is a process of removing objects that are not seen by the camera from the frame. Culling is also used for removing a hidden surface in the graphics processor. 2.Clipping … bird meredith vance facebook https://creativebroadcastprogramming.com

graphics - Which stage of pipeline should I do culling and …

WebA culling method is used to track the visibility state of each Actor in your level. The scene's data is culled and tested against whichever method (s) are being employed by your project. The following culling methods are … WebWhat is Culling in Photography? Culling in photography is simply the process of selecting the final images you wish to keep from a shoot. This can involve actively rejecting photos in some way, deleting them entirely, or simply choosing the best images and ignoring everything else. WebClipping, in the context of computer graphics, is a method to selectively enable or disable rendering operations within a defined region of interest. Mathematically, clipping can be described using the terminology of constructive geometry. A rendering algorithm only draws pixels in the intersection between the clip region and the scene model. bird medications

Graphics.DrawMesh/DrawMeshInstanced fundamentally bottlenecked by …

Category:US7388582B2 - System and method for graphics culling - Google

Tags:Graphic culling

Graphic culling

Greg Gersch - Graphic Recording - Washington DC - Maryland

WebUnity’s graphics tools enable you to create optimized graphics in any style, across a range of platforms – from mobile to high-end consoles and desktop. This process usually … WebMar 16, 2015 · After back-face and depth culling, not all triangles may need pixels on the screen. The screen size of a triangle can mean it requires millions of pixels or none at all. As a consequence modern GPUs let their …

Graphic culling

Did you know?

WebDec 10, 2024 · hausmaus. Use this function in situations where you want to draw the same mesh for a particular amount of times using an instanced shader. Meshes are not further culled by the view frustum or baked occluders, nor sorted for transparency or z efficiency. The only suggestion that I have seen which almost worked is to set the Y value of the … WebApr 7, 2024 · In the top menu, select Window > Rendering > Occlusion Culling to open the Occlusion Culling window. Select the Bake tab. In the bottom right hand corner of the Inspector window, press the Bake button. Unity generates the occlusion culling data, saves the data as an asset in your Project, and links the asset with the current Scene (s).

WebApr 7, 2024 · Occlusion culling. Occlusion culling is a process which prevents Unity from performing rendering calculations for GameObjects The fundamental object in Unity scenes, which can represent characters, … WebIn one embodiment, a method for using a graphics processing unit (GPU) to cull an object database is disclosed. The method comprises encoding per-object parameters and culling parameters. The...

WebOct 9, 2000 · Perhaps the most obvious form of culling is view frustum culling, which is based on the fact that only the objects in the current view volume must be drawn. View volume is usually defined by six planes, namely the front, back, left, right, top, and bottom clipping planes, which together form a cut pyramid. WebFace culling is a way to avoid rendering such primitives. Rasterization Main article: Rasterization Primitives that reach this stage are then rasterized in the order in which they were given. The result of rasterizing a primitive is …

WebSep 16, 2024 · The way Graphics.DrawProcedural works is that all the shader gets as information is the index of the current vertex. That also means we’ll have to make the vertices available to shader ourselves via more compute buffers and then write a custom shader to read from those buffers. Lets add a mesh and a material to our public class …

WebCPU culling workload - Controls the granularity of CPU culling operations. A higher value improves GPU performance at the cost of CPU performance. (Small / Medium / Large / Extreme) Max render queue frames - Controls the maximum number of frames the graphics driver is allowed to queue up. bird memorial giftsWebNov 13, 2016 · When you call Graphics.DrawMesh, it just inserts the relevant data structure used for rendering into the Queue and clears it out before the next frame; culling/batching/etc still happen as normal. Would this changes allow me to skip using normal GameObjects with MeshRender and just pass inn an array of matrix' to render … dam health manchester covid testhttp://www.differencebetween.net/technology/software-technology/difference-between-clipping-and-culling/ dam health london ukWebOct 5, 2024 · 5.The clipping technique is used when the objects are partially visible. By utilizing the clipping technique, the video quality is increased and the frame rate is … dam health manchester addressWebApr 8, 2024 · Fortunately, there are mods for this situation too. The Shadow Remover mod takes the blocky shadows that distractingly flicker over … dam health newcastle staffsWebOct 21, 2024 · The occlusion culling technology improves rendering performance by rendering visible objects only. It is used to detect and prevent occluded objects from … dam health newcastle villageWebFeb 8, 2024 · Level of Detail, sometimes shortened to just LOD, or occasionally lumped in with Draw Distance, is a staple graphics setting which affects the visual quality of objects rendered in the game world ... dam health nags head road